针对2026年最新发布的OpenClaw v4.2.0及后续版本,本文深入解析核心模块的更新日志与版本变化,并提供针对性的故障排查方案。无论您是遇到API接口调用超时、硬件兼容性报错,还是配置文件异常导致的服务中断,都能在此找到从日志分析到恢复默认设置的实操指南,助您快速恢复生产环境。
随着2026年OpenClaw架构的全面升级,新版本在提升并发处理能力的同时,也引入了更严格的配置校验机制。许多开发者在平滑升级或日常运维中,频繁遭遇服务启动失败或节点失联的困扰。本文将直击痛点,结合最新版更新日志,为您拆解高频故障的排查链路。
在2026年2月发布的OpenClaw v4.2.0版本中,官方对底层通信协议进行了重构,废弃了原有的`legacy_tcp_mode`参数,强制启用TLS 1.3双向认证。这导致许多直接覆盖升级的用户在启动服务时,控制台狂刷“Error 104: Handshake Timeout”报错。排查此故障时,首先需检查`/etc/openclaw/network.conf`文件,确认是否残留旧版参数。解决方法是手动删除废弃字段,并使用命令`openclaw-cli cert --renew`重新生成符合新版安全标准的证书链,重启守护进程即可恢复节点间的正常通信。
随着版本迭代,OpenClaw对硬件加速模块的调用逻辑发生了变化。在v4.2.5的更新日志中明确指出,已停止对CUDA 11.x及更早版本驱动的原生支持。如果您的运行环境未及时更新,系统日志(通常位于`/var/log/openclaw/gpu_worker.log`)中会出现“CUDA_ERROR_UNSUPPORTED_PTX_VERSION”的致命错误,导致任务队列阻塞。此时的排查步骤非常明确:首先运行`nvidia-smi`确认当前驱动版本,若低于535.xx,必须立即执行驱动升级。对于无法升级的老旧机房,建议在启动参数中追加`--fallback-cpu-only`以牺牲性能换取系统可用性。
意外断电或磁盘I/O异常极易导致OpenClaw的核心配置文件`config.yaml`出现语法截断。2026年的新版引入了严格的YAML校验器,一旦发现格式错误,进程将直接抛出“Fatal: Invalid YAML structure”并拒绝启动。面对这种配置异常,盲目修改往往适得其反。最安全且高效的恢复策略是利用内置的灾备机制:执行`openclaw-admin reset --hard`命令。该指令会强制备份当前损坏的配置文件至`/tmp`目录,并从只读分区提取出厂默认配置进行覆盖。随后,您只需根据业务需求,重新填入数据库连接串和鉴权密钥即可。
在处理OpenClaw长期运行后出现的OOM(内存溢出)崩溃时,常规的Info或Warning级别日志往往无法提供足够的上下文。根据2026年Q3的更新日志与版本变化,开发团队新增了内存碎片实时监控探针。当遇到不明原因的内存飙升时,您需要动态调整日志输出等级。通过向主进程发送特定信号或修改环境变量`OC_LOG_LEVEL=TRACE`,开启深度追踪模式。在此模式下,日志会详细记录每个内存块的分配与释放周期。结合官方提供的`oc-mem-analyzer`脚本分析Trace日志,能够精准定位是哪个自定义插件或异常请求导致了内存未被及时回收。
这通常是因为新版API接口签名发生了变化。请查阅更新日志中关于“Plugin API v2”的迁移指南,您需要将插件代码中的`init_module()`函数替换为新的异步注册方法,并重新编译。
不会。`openclaw-admin reset`命令仅针对环境配置文件(如网络、端口、鉴权规则)进行初始化,您的业务数据和历史任务队列均安全存储在独立的数据库实例中,不受重置操作影响。
该问题多发于内网隔离环境。2026版本优化了防伪验证机制,要求每24小时与授权服务器进行一次心跳同步。请检查防火墙规则,确保出站TCP端口443对`auth.openclaw.dev`开放,或在设置中配置合规的代理服务器。
遇到更复杂的底层报错?立即访问OpenClaw开发者中心,下载《2026年度OpenClaw故障排查与性能调优白皮书》,或提交工单获取技术专家的1对1支持。
相关阅读:openclaw 故障排查 更新日志与版本变化 2026,openclaw 故障排查 更新日志与版本变化 2026使用技巧,彻底解决配置异常:openclaw 恢复默认 下载与安装指南 202603